Main Features and Details

The payment infrastructure of instant withdrawal casinos is characterized by several key features that contribute to withdrawal speed. Firstly, the integration of advanced payment gateways allows for real-time processing of transactions. These gateways act as intermediaries between the casino and financial institutions, ensuring that funds are transferred swiftly and securely. Secondly, the use of digital wallets, such as PayPal and Neteller, has gained popularity due to their ability to facilitate instant transactions without the delays often associated with traditional banking methods.

Moreover, the verification process is a critical aspect of withdrawal speed. Casinos that implement efficient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ols can expedite the verification of player identities, allowing for quicker access to funds. Additionally, partnerships with banks that offer instant payment services can significantly reduce withdrawal times, as these institutions are equipped to handle transactions more rapidly than others.

Practical Examples and Use Cases

To illustrate the impact of payment infrastructure on withdrawal speed, consider the case of a player who wins a significant amount at an instant withdrawal casino. If the platform utilizes a well-integrated payment gateway and supports multiple digital wallets, the player can expect to receive their winnings within minutes. For instance, a player using an e-wallet may initiate a withdrawal and see the funds reflected in their account almost immediately, whereas a player relying on bank transfers might face delays of several days.

Another example can be seen in the varying experiences across different platforms. Some casinos may offer instant withdrawals for specific payment methods, while others may impose waiting periods for traditional banking options. This variability highlights the importance of understanding the payment infrastructure when analyzing different casinos, as it directly affects user satisfaction and retention.

Advantages and Disadvantages

While the benefits of a robust payment infrastructure are clear, there are also potential drawbacks to consider. One significant advantage is the enhanced user experience that comes with fast withdrawals. Players are more likely to return to platforms that provide quick access to their funds, leading to increased loyalty and higher revenues for the casino.

However, there are disadvantages as well. For instance, the reliance on digital wallets and payment gateways can introduce vulnerabilities, such as cybersecurity risks. Additionally, not all players may have access to these modern payment methods, potentially alienating a segment of the market that prefers traditional banking options. Furthermore, the costs associated with maintaining advanced payment systems can be substantial, impacting the overall profitability of the casino.
